#828cb4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#828cb4 is composed of 51% red, 54.9%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.8% cyan, 22.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 228 degrees, a saturation of 25% and a lightness of 60.8%. #828cb4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#051969.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#828cb4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#828cb4 has RGB values of R:130, G:140,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 8555700.
